How We Remove Shower Pan Leaks in Sidney, IA
When you call us, our team will follow a meticulous process to ensure a thorough and efficient removal of the leak. We’ll begin by assessing the damage and identifying the source of the leak. From there, we’ll use specialized equipment to extract the water and dry out the area, preventing further damage to your property.
Step 1: Assessment and Planning
We’ll carefully inspect the shower pan to find out the extent of the damage and identify the source of the leak. Our team will then create a detailed plan to restore your shower pan to its original condition.
Step 2: Water Extraction
We’ll use advanced equipment to extract the water from the shower pan, including wet/dry vacuums and pumps. This helps prevent further damage and reduces the risk of mold and mildew growth.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Our team will use specialized equipment to dry out the area and remove any excess moisture. This helps prevent further damage and reduces the risk of mold and mildew growth.
Step 4: Repair and Restoration
Once the area is dry, our team will repair and restore your shower pan to its original condition. This may involve replacing any damaged materials or re-lining the shower pan.
Step 5: Final Inspection and Cleaning
Our team will conduct a final inspection to ensure the area is dry and free of any damage. We’ll also clean the area thoroughly to prevent any further issues.

Warning Signs You Need Shower Pan Leak Water Removal
Catching the signs of a shower pan leak early can save you money and prevent bigger problems. Keep an eye out for these warning signs: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Strong, persistent odors in your shower or bathroom may show a leak. Don’t ignore these signs; they can lead to mold and mildew growth.
Water Stains on the Ceiling or Walls
Water stains on your ceiling or walls can be a sign of a shower pan leak. These stains can be a sign of a larger issue that needs attention.
Warped or Buckled Flooring
Warped or buckled flooring around your shower can be a sign of a leak. This can be a costly issue to repair if left unchecked.
Increased Water Bills
Unexplained increases in your water bills may show a shower pan leak. This can be a sign of a larger issue that needs attention.
Visible Water Leaks
Visible water leaks around your shower can be a sign of a serious issue. Don’t ignore these signs; they can lead to costly damage and health risks.

Common Questions About Shower Pan Leak Water Removal
Will my insurance cover the cost of Shower Pan Leak Water Removal?
Yes, most insurance policies cover water damage and leaks. But, it’s essential to review your policy and contact your insurance provider to find out the specifics of your coverage.
How long will the restoration process take?
The length of the restoration process depends on the severity of the leak and the size of the affected area. Typically, the process can take anywhere from 3-5 days, but it may take longer in complex cases.
What equipment will be used during the restoration process?
We use advanced equipment, including wet/dry vacuums, pumps, and dehumidifiers, to extract water and dry out the area.
Will I need to replace my shower pan?
In some cases, yes, you may need to replace your shower pan. But, our team will assess the damage and provide a detailed plan to restore your shower pan to its original condition.
Can I try to fix the leak myself?
While DIY repairs may be possible for small, isolated leaks, it’s not recommended to try to fix complex leaks or water damage on your own. This can lead to further damage and health risks.
